"The Sensitivity of WRF Forecasts to their Initial
Conditions"
Dr.
Brian Etherton
University of North Carolina at Charlotte
ABSTRACT
Mesoscale weather features can have a
significant impact on day to day weather forecasts when they represent the
primary forcing (e.g., South Florida in the summertime). Some features are: tropical waves, sea
breezes, land breezes, thermal troughs, and outflow boundaries. Many of these
features are not represented properly in the guidance from the National Centers
for Environmental Prediction (NCEP).
The results of a sensitivity study
of Weather Research and Forecasting (WRF) Model forecasts for South Florida to initial and boundary conditions
are presented. For initial conditions, either NAM model analyses or analyses produced
by the Local Analysis and Prediction System (LAPS) at the Weather Service
Forecast Office in Miami are used. To further improve the
initial conditions, alternative data assimilation schemes to LAPS are
explored. One scheme that shows promise
is the Ensemble Kalman Filter (EnKF). The EnKF is the key
element in the Data Assimilation Research Testbed
(DART).
An introduction to Ensemble Kalman
Filters, and the use of DART to assimilate radar data for improved prediction
of the weather in the Houston area, will conclude the talk.
